Emily Dickinson bound her poems in collections she called what?

Respuesta :

sarahhambuechen
sarahhambuechen sarahhambuechen
  • 03-12-2020

Answer:

fascicles

Explanation:

During Dickinson's intense writing period (1858-1864), she copied more than 800 of her poems into small booklets, forty in all, now called “fascicles.” Dickinson made the small volumes herself from folded sheets of paper that she stacked and then bound
